A spectacle by Toby Schmitz
Christmas, 1925. Somewhere on the Atlantic. Welcome aboard the ocean liner Empress of Australia as it steams towards New York with a full complement of passengers – a Chicago bag-man, a South African fighter pilot, a London society ‘it’ girl, a serial killer, and one dogged ship’s detective. The scene is set for a murder mystery at sea. What unravels is far darker. Prepare yourselves for a rough crossing.
This epic new play by Toby Schmitz is directed by Schmitz’s long time collaborator, Rock Surfers Artistic Director Leland Kean. After their 2012 critically acclaimed and award winning production, I want to sleep with Tom Stoppard, Schmitz and Kean bring to life one of the most ambitious and epic productions to hit Sydney stages in 2013.
Be transported back to the high-water mark of the British Empire for the kind of gothic thrills that will leave you haunted long after you disembark the Empress.
